The scientists of the National Institute of Modern Research determine strategic
partnership as a type of inter-state relations, built as a coherent system of interaction
between states in pursuit of common strategic objectives, interests and goals. Unlike
the allied relations, strategic partnership, in their opinion, does not provide for a rigid
system of political, economic, humanitarian or security obligations [2].
